Telfort used to have it's own netwerk (with also it's own network code, to be exactly 20412). In 2005 Telfort was taken over by KPN (networkcode 20408) and slowly the Telfort network was shutdown. Now they still use their own network code and that's why they are roaming on the network of KPN.
Hi and MTV mobile etc are MNVO's and use the network code of KPN, with only a different display/carrier name.

As far as I know they should be stored on the SIM. There is a problem with some devices either ignoring the preferred networks list entirely, or loosing the settings (as they are SIM-locked by the provider so the saving to SIm fails silently).
Check with your SIM/Network provider - they will be able to tell you if you can change the settings or not. On some networks, and with some SIMS you just can't.

The operator logo in the dialer does not automatically change when you switch networks / sim cards.
It depends on the image file 'carrierlogo.gif' in the Windows folder.
I have an unlocked T-Mobile MDA Vario with an Orange sim card - this showed as T-Mobile until I updated the carrierlogo.gif file!
If you want to view the network you are currently connected to, go to Start | Settings | Phone | Network.

Have you tried another QTek ROM? Otherwise, it's a possible SIM-related issue. The SIM hasn't received an OTA (Over the Air) update telling it that it is connected to T-Mobile's local switch. Furthermore, you shouldn't be on the shared network anymore since the old GSM 1900 shared network was sold to T-Mobile in CA and NV as part of the Cingular/AT&T merger. I would think that T-Mobile has updated that GSM 1900-only network to broadcast only their MNC (Network Code) so any T-Mobile SIMs registered on the network know that it is a native network.

It's just the name of the mobile network. There is a tiny database on your phone('s radio ROM, I presume) looking up the correct name for your network based on the network ID(23106). Flashing your phone to (a more) recent version should resolve this (in the future) since it updates this database on your phone.
